Configurer le spoke de l’instance ServiceNow distante
Intégrez les instances locales et distantes ServiceNow en créant un point de terminaison d’API OAuth dans l’instance distante ServiceNow pour authentifier les demandes.
Avant de commencer
- Demandez un Centre d'intégration abonnement.
- Activez le spoke d’instance ServiceNow distant dans les instances distantes et locales ServiceNow .Remarque :Les termes instance distante et instance locale sont utilisés dans les contextes suivants :
- Instance locale : instance ServiceNow à partir de laquelle la communication est initiée et établie.
- Instance distante : instance ServiceNow avec laquelle l’instance locale communique.
- Rôle requis : admin.Remarque :Le rôle administrateur est nécessaire pour configurer uniquement le spoke.
Pour utiliser le spoke, assurez-vous que les utilisateurs du spoke ne disposent que des autorisations minimales requises pour accéder aux données des ServiceNow tables. N’affectez pas de rôles de privilège élevé aux utilisateurs de ce spoke, sauf si cela est nécessaire. Cette pratique garantit un accès contrôlé aux données.
Les utilisateurs d’intégration doivent disposer du flow_operator et des autres rôles requis pour accéder à la table avec laquelle ils souhaitent interagir. Ils ont également besoin de rôles pour accéder aux tables Table [sys_db_object] et Entrée de dictionnaire [sys_dictionary] afin d’afficher des options dynamiques telles que des noms de table et des champs dans une table.
Enregistrer l’instance distante ServiceNow en tant que fournisseur OAuth
Enregistrez l’instance distante ServiceNow en tant que fournisseur OAuth afin que l’instance locale ServiceNow puisse demander des jetons OAuth 2.0.
Avant de commencer
- Dans l’instance distante ServiceNow :
- Créez un point de terminaison d’API OAuth pour les clients externes. Dans URL de redirection, spécifiez l’URL de l’instance locale ServiceNow au format suivant : https://<nom-instance>.service-now.com/oauth_redirect.do. Pour plus d’informations, consultez Créer un point de terminaison pour permettre aux clients d’accéder à l’instance.
- Copiez et enregistrez les valeurs d’ID client et de Secret client.
- Rôle requis : admin
Procédure
Créer un enregistrement d’informations d’identification pour l’instance distante ServiceNow
Créez un enregistrement d’informations d’identification pour l’instance distante ServiceNow . Les alias de connexion et d’informations d’identification du spoke ServiceNow Remote Instance utilisent ces informations d’identification pour autoriser des actions.
Avant de commencer
Procédure
Créer un enregistrement de connexion pour l’instance distante ServiceNow
Créez un enregistrement de connexion pour votre instance distante ServiceNow . Les alias de connexion et d’informations d’identification du spoke ServiceNow Remote Instance utilisent ces connexions pour effectuer des actions.
Avant de commencer
Procédure
Créer un enregistrement d’informations d’identification pour l’instance locale ServiceNow
Créez un enregistrement d’informations d’identification pour l’instance locale ServiceNow . Les alias de connexion et d’informations d’identification du spoke ServiceNow Remote Instance utilisent ces informations d’identification pour autoriser des actions.
Avant de commencer
Procédure
Créer un enregistrement de connexion pour l’instance locale ServiceNow
Créez un enregistrement de connexion pour votre instance locale ServiceNow . Les alias de connexion et d’informations d’identification du spoke ServiceNow Remote Instance utilisent ces connexions pour effectuer des actions.